Transaction ed8785c2156fb515c7605bdbd59feeb80a54f11c24e449645791de664d30f40d

1 Input
2 Outputs
  • ed8785c2156fb515c7605bdbd59feeb80a54f11c24e449645791de664d30f40d:0
  • value  18176
    address  17hhxbBUouxX5PGEjL5cSZzzFCuopX1t6Z
  • ed8785c2156fb515c7605bdbd59feeb80a54f11c24e449645791de664d30f40d:1
  • value  1978356
    address  3H5KmPLaSMj33TEd6WGyzwQGKH6m1APMQt